San Diego's Old Town was the first European settlement on the West Coast and is known as the birthplace of California. The Historic Park encompasses 37 historic buildings. Three original adobe houses have been restored. The Casa de Machado y Silvas (aka "House of the Flag") is where the Mexican flag was hidden from American troops during the Mexican-American War. Mission Hills is an affluent neighborhood overlooking Old Town, Downtown San Diego and San Diego Bay. The area was developed in the early 20th century with homes designed by San Diego's premier architects including William Hebbard and William Templeton Johnson. Most of the homes today are restored and carefully preserved. The famous horticulturalist Kate Sessions, founder of the renowned Mission Hills Nursery, influenced the development of Mission Hills.
